BNDX ETF Climbs 0.1%
Dow Jones2026/08/11 20:35This article was automatically generated using Dow Jones technology.
Shares of Vanguard Total International Bond ETF rose 0.1% to $47.82 Tuesday on what proved to be an overall negative trading session for the U.S. stock market, with the S&P 500 Index falling 0.3% to 7,728.20.
The ETF's shares closed 4.2% below the 52-week high of $49.93 seen on October 28, 2025.
Trading volume was 3,139,850, compared to the 65-day average trading volume of 4,712,314.
As of August 10, the fund's net asset value totaled $47.69 per share.
